Understanding AutoCAD iExtensionApplication for Enhanced Design Efficiency

Introduction to AutoCAD iExtensionApplication

AutoCAD is a powerful software application widely used in various industries for computer-aided design and drafting. Its versatility and extensive features make it an essential tool for architects, engineers, and designers. One of the key aspects that enhance the functionality of AutoCAD is the ability to extend its capabilities through the use of applications. Among these applications, the iExtensionApplication stands out as a significant component that allows developers to create custom functionalities tailored to specific needs.

The iExtensionApplication is part of the AutoCAD .NET API, which provides a robust framework for building applications that integrate seamlessly with AutoCAD. This extension application enables developers to create plugins that can automate tasks, enhance user interfaces, and introduce new commands or tools that are not available in the standard version of AutoCAD. By leveraging the iExtensionApplication, users can streamline their workflows, improve productivity, and customize their design processes to better suit their unique requirements.

Understanding the iExtensionApplication is crucial for developers looking to harness the full potential of AutoCAD. It serves as a bridge between the core functionalities of AutoCAD and the custom features that can be developed to meet specific project demands. This introduction will explore the significance of the iExtensionApplication in the context of AutoCAD, highlighting its role in enhancing user experience and expanding the software’s capabilities.

As industries continue to evolve, the need for specialized tools and applications becomes increasingly important. The iExtensionApplication empowers developers to respond to these needs by providing a platform for innovation within the AutoCAD environment. Whether it is automating repetitive tasks, integrating with other software, or creating entirely new tools, the possibilities are vast and varied.

In the following sections of this article, we will delve deeper into the functionalities and benefits of the iExtensionApplication, providing insights into how it can be effectively utilized in AutoCAD projects. By understanding its capabilities and implementation strategies, users can unlock new levels of efficiency and creativity in their design processes.

Exploring the Features of AutoCAD iExtensionApplication

The AutoCAD iExtensionApplication is a vital tool for developers aiming to customize and enhance the AutoCAD environment. This extension application allows for the creation of tailored solutions that can significantly improve user experience and project efficiency. By understanding its core features and functionalities, developers can leverage this tool to meet specific industry demands.

Understanding iExtensionApplication

At its core, the iExtensionApplication serves as a framework that integrates custom applications with AutoCAD. It is built on the .NET platform, making it accessible for developers familiar with languages such as C# and VB.NET. This compatibility allows for the development of sophisticated applications that can interact with AutoCAD objects and commands seamlessly.

The iExtensionApplication can be loaded into AutoCAD as a plugin, allowing users to access new commands and tools directly within the software. This integration is crucial for automating repetitive tasks, which can save time and reduce the likelihood of errors in design processes. Developers can create commands that perform complex operations with a single click, streamlining workflows and enhancing productivity.

Key Features of iExtensionApplication

One of the standout features of the iExtensionApplication is its ability to create custom user interfaces. Developers can design dialog boxes, tool palettes, and ribbons that cater to specific user needs. This customization enhances the overall user experience by providing intuitive access to the tools and commands that users require most frequently.

Additionally, the iExtensionApplication supports event handling, allowing developers to respond to user actions in real-time. This feature enables the creation of dynamic applications that can adapt to user input, providing a more interactive experience. For example, a developer can create an application that updates a drawing based on user selections, making the design process more fluid and responsive.

Integration with Other Technologies

The iExtensionApplication also facilitates integration with other software and technologies. Developers can connect AutoCAD with databases, web services, and other applications, enabling data exchange and collaboration across platforms. This capability is particularly beneficial for teams working on large projects that require coordination among various stakeholders.

For instance, a developer could create an application that pulls data from a project management tool and updates AutoCAD drawings accordingly. This integration not only saves time but also ensures that all team members are working with the most current information, reducing the risk of discrepancies and miscommunication.

Benefits of Using iExtensionApplication

The benefits of utilizing the iExtensionApplication are numerous. First and foremost, it allows for significant time savings by automating repetitive tasks. This automation reduces the manual effort required for routine operations, enabling designers to focus on more creative aspects of their work.

Moreover, the customization options available through the iExtensionApplication empower users to tailor AutoCAD to their specific needs. This flexibility means that teams can develop workflows that align perfectly with their project requirements, enhancing overall efficiency.

Finally, the ability to integrate with other technologies opens up new avenues for collaboration and data management. By connecting AutoCAD with external systems, teams can streamline their processes and improve communication, ultimately leading to better project outcomes.

Conclusions

The AutoCAD iExtensionApplication is a powerful tool that significantly enhances the capabilities of AutoCAD. By allowing developers to create custom applications, automate tasks, and integrate with other technologies, it provides a pathway for improved efficiency and productivity. As industries continue to evolve, the importance of such customizable solutions cannot be overstated. Embracing the iExtensionApplication can lead to innovative workflows and a more streamlined design process, ultimately benefiting users and organizations alike.